The Old Testament reading we heard from Jeremiah talks about the destruction of Judah and the pain and suffering felt by its people. The destruction was caused by the sins of the people. Jeremiah identified with the people and their pain and suffering. We as Christians must also identify with people and their struggles and pain, especially when they sin. That doesn’t mean that we join them if they sin. We have to open our hearts to the people we serve. When we do, we show God’s love. All of us need comfort at some point in our lives. There’s no such thing as a pain-free life. God allows pain and suffering because they draw us closer to him. Our pain creates a need for God.
